Tara Lehan, Phd work experience

A career timeline built from the work history available for this profile.

Director Of Strategic Research

Serve as a resource for all academic programs and departments under the Office of the Provost. Provide support and guidance in making data-informed decisions through the completion of integrative critical reviews of the literature and environmental scans of peer institutions as well as assessment of learning, evaluation, and quality assurance initiatives. Serve as a (1) primary investigator for university-directed research projects, (2) consultant for university stakeholders engaged in research towards continuous improvement, and (3) partner to all university stakeholders in the creation and enhancement of quality assurance protocols. Make recommendations to improve policies, processes, and/or stakeholder experiences. Collaborate with university stakeholders to ensure that research and strategic initiatives are designed in alignment with the university’s mission, vision, values, and strategic plan. Provide timely and relevant information to university decision makers impacting student success and institutional effectiveness. Helping to inform an inventory of best practices in online teaching and learning using a personalized approach.

Feb 2019 - Nov 2022

Director Of Learning Resources (Previously Special Projects, Then Faculty And Student Resources)

Support and mentor 20+ individuals who make up the Faculty Scheduling/Academic Services, Academic Success Center, and Library teams; Oversee the development, implementation, and updating of the strategic plan for these three teams; Lead quality assurance and co-curricular assessment of student learning initiatives for the two student-facing teams; Conduct process and outcome evaluations to promote continuous improvement in areas, including but not limited to academic coaching, library consultations, faculty workload, task fee payment processing, and eBook initiatives; Lead hiring and retention efforts with an emphasis on diversity, inclusion, and equity; Transitioned Academic Success Center from a tutoring model to a coaching model that involves a personalized coaching plan for each student; Transited processes as appropriate when one or more teams was an unnecessary pass through; Collect and analyze data to ensure that university resources are being used efficiently and services match the desires and needs of students; Facilitate relevant, engaging experiences using multiple modalities to share information with students, faculty, staff, and administrators; Evaluate and select appropriate tools and technologies to execute in areas of responsibilities; Create and manage budgets and negotiate lowest prices with vendors

Jan 2015 - Feb 2019

Interim Director Of Institutional Research

Developed primary research to enhance the experience of students and faculty members. Reviewed and revised all survey instruments administered to students, faculty members, and/or staff members. Supervised statistician who authored various internal reports. Guided consultants in the development of key performance indicators and a business intelligence system to help to inform university planning, policy, and decision making.

Mar 2014 - Dec 2014

Director Of Research Curriculum And Practice

Completed quality assessment of feedback provided by dissertation reviewers and used findings to inform trainings and interactions with reviewers and chairs. Provided feedback on research methodology/design and statistical analysis to students working on the dissertation who were struggling to obtain approval of milestone documents. Consulted with dissertation chairs on matters relating to research methodology/design. Developed research courses collaboratively (Statistics I, Statistics II) and independently (Advanced Quantitative Measurement, Program Evaluation) one month before the deadline. Developed program evaluation with colleagues of new research courses and the curriculum as a whole. Selected by university leaders to serve as lead on a major retention study.

Jun 2013 - Mar 2014

Research Specialist

Facilitated research methodology and design consultations with dissertation chairs and doctoral candidates. Developed research methodology and statistics courses. Reviewed dissertation proposals and manuscripts. Serve as dissertation chair for diverse students.

Nov 2011 - Jun 2013

Consultant, Item Writer

Center For Aid In Education

Developed items to assess student competence associated with the objectives in a graduate biostatistics course at a Research I institution.

May 2015 - Jul 2015

Consultant, Subject Matter Expert/Author

Adapt Courseware

Authored activities to assess student competence associated with the objectives of a section of content for two courses (Introduction to Statistics and College Algebra) at a Research I institution using best practices informed by scholarly literature on learning, particularly cognitive load theory.

Apr 2014 - Jul 2014

Instructor

Taught doctoral-level marriage and family therapy course with diverse students.

Jan 2011 - Dec 2011

Postdoctoral Fellow (Research)

Richmond, Virginia Area

Worked as part of an interdisciplinary research team to conduct psychosocial research, serving as first author on several manuscripts

Jan 2010 - Dec 2011

Associate Editor

Edited documents, including cover letters, formal business correspondences, handbooks, memos, newsletters, resumes, website content, theses, and dissertations, in addition to brochures (PDF), presentations (PowerPoint), and spreadsheets (Excel); demonstrated expertise in the following academic writing style: APA, CSE, Chicago, Turabian, and MLA.

Feb 2008 - Nov 2011

Postdoctoral Fellow (Teaching And Supervision)

Columbus, Ohio Area

Developed and taught courses at the undergraduate, master's, and doctoral levels synchronously and asynchronously; supervised doctoral-level therapists-in-training; coordinated family therapy clinic activities

Aug 2008 - Dec 2009

Instructor

Taught Fundamentals of Social Science Research and Epistemology of Practice Knowledge to diverse students.

2008 - 2009 ~1 yr

Predoctoral Intern

Dallas/Fort Worth Area

Conducted telephone interviews with prospective participants and live interviews with enrolled participants, entered all participant data in an SPSS database, actively participated in weekly telephone supervision meetings with master emotionally-focused therapists as part of a federally funded research project; provided therapeutic services to underserved lung and breast cancer patients and their loved ones; participated in multidisciplinary treatment teams at an urban community hospital.

Aug 2006 - Aug 2007
